Developmental Disabilities Waiver

The Developmental Disabilities (DD) Waiver program also known in New Mexico as the “traditional DD waiver” is designed to provide Services and Supports that assist eligible children and adults with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ities (IDD) to participate as active members of their communities. The DD Waiver is one of several waivers available in New Mexico. The program serves as an alternative to institutional care.

New Mexico’s traditional DD Waiver Program is a person-centered, community-oriented approach to deliver supports for people with intellectual and developmental disabilities (IDD). The approach emphasizes:

  • That people with IDD oversee their lives as much as possible.
  • That people with IDD have opportunities to use resources in ways that enhance their lives and help them participate in their communities.
  • A shared responsibility for the wise use of public dollars and the contribution that people with IDD and their families can make.
  • That the system is managed in a way that is efficient and fair to everyone.
